Researcher Publishes 10 Million Usernames and Passwords from Data Breaches

A security researcher has released a set of 10 million usernames and passwords. Mark Burnett collected the data from major data breaches at big companies including Adobe Data Breach and Stratfor hack. Most of the leaked passwords were “dead,” meaning they had been changed already, according to Burnett. The researcher says the released data is important for other researchers to analyze and provide great insight into user behavior and is valuable for encouraging password security. However, Burnett says he is not supposed to be arrested by law enforcement agencies.
